In this canvas, I've channeled serenity and the depth of the ocean, using acrylic and oil to meld together minimalism with an abstract, geometric touch. The addition of sand brings a textured dimensionality, evoking the tactile sensation of a shoreline. The cool blues and whites offer a tranquil, yet introspective ambiance, imbuing your space with the calming energy of a seaside retreat. Oto Macek is a contemporary glassmaker and painter from the Czech Republic. Macek is a graduate of Secondary Glass Art School in 1983 - 87 in Železný Brod, 1987 - 93 Academy of Applied Arts, Prague, Czech Republic.His painting practice focuses on creating geometric abstractions of landscape and architecture. His paintings are painted by layering the relief elements with oil and acrylic paint. Macek's paintings are soothing, symbiotic works that professionally they balance colors and light. Oto Macek creates glass objects inspired by modern and historical architecture. He also creates 3D graphics, photography and music.
